    Abstract: A method for determining a piston position of a piston in a hydraulic cylinder drive includes (i) providing a dynamic model of the cylinder drive, (ii) controlling driving of the cylinder drive with a control signal, (iii) detecting a real piston position of the piston, and (iv) adjusting parameters of the model on the basis of the real piston position. The model maps components of the cylinder drive and outputs a calculated piston position of the piston on the basis of detected operating parameters of the cylinder drive. A method of operating an arrangement having a corresponding hydraulic cylinder drive and a mechanism for implementing the methods are also disclosed herein.

    Abstract: The disclosure relates to a method for operating a hydraulic drive which comprises a hydraulic consumer with a positionable piston in a cylinder which is connected to a tank at one connection via a pump of variable rotational speed and at another connection via a proportional valve, wherein a position of the piston is controlled using a model-based control in which a rotational speed of the pump is used as a manipulated variable and in which a position of the proportional valve is preset.
